Compare all specifications:

1963 Alfa Romeo Giulia 1965 Chevrolet Corvette
Make Alfa Romeo Chevrolet
Model Giulia Corvette
Year Released 1963 1965
Engine Position Front Front
Engine Size 1570 cc 5354 cc
Engine Cylinders 4 cylinders 8 cylinders
Engine Type in-line V
Horse Power 115 HP 301 HP
Torque 145 Nm 488 Nm
Torque RPM 4400 RPM 3400 RPM
Engine Bore Size 78.1 mm 101.6 mm
Engine Stroke Size 82 mm 82.6 mm
Fuel Type Gasoline Gasoline
Number of Seats 5 seats 2 seats
Number of Doors 4 doors 2 doors
Vehicle Weight 1050 kg 1440 kg
Vehicle Length 4150 mm 4450 mm
Vehicle Width 1570 mm 1770 mm
Vehicle Height 1440 mm 1260 mm
Wheelbase Size 2520 mm 2500 mm
Fuel Tank Capacity 46 L 76 L
